Frequently Asked Questions About Buying a Baby Female Sulphur-Crested Cockatoo
How does a 5.1-month-old female Sulphur-Crested Cockatoo typically behave?
At this age, Maelia is inquisitive and socially responsive, while still forming habits shaped by routine, calm handling, and enrichment.
Is a baby female cockatoo easier to bond with than an older bird?
Many owners find early bonding smoother with babies, as consistent care and interaction help establish trust from the beginning.
What kind of enrichment is best for a young Sulphur-Crested Cockatoo?
Age-appropriate toys, soft chewables, gentle foraging activities, and supervised exploration help support mental and physical development.
How long does it take for a baby cockatoo to settle into a new home?
Adjustment varies, but most baby cockatoos begin recognizing routines within a few weeks when the environment remains predictable and calm.
What should I plan for long-term care when choosing a baby cockatoo?
Choosing a baby means planning for decades of companionship, daily interaction, ongoing enrichment, and consistent veterinary care as the bird matures.
